#9bb001 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9bb001 is composed of 60.8% red, 69%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.4%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 67.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 34.7%. #9bb001 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ff02 with #376100.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

Shades and Tints of #9bb001

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fdffec is the lightest one.

Tones of #9bb001

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d5e53 is the less saturated color, while #9bb001 is the most saturated one.
